Chapter 137

Shyla’s eyes flickered, and she said, “What? What are you talking about?”

Thalia stepped forward and locked eyes with Shyla. “Mom, you know Grandma desperately wants those sapphire carrings back. Why did you tell Dad there’s no such thing? Don’t you care about Grandma at all?”

Her sharp stare made Shyla uncomfortable. Shyla frowned and set the scissors down on the table with a crisp clink.

“Stay out of this,” Shyla said, her tone turning cold.

“Why?” Thalia didn’t understand. “Those earrings are Grandma and Grandpa’s love token. She’s been thinking about them for years. You’re her daughter, so why won’t you help her?”

“I said stay out of it!” Shyla’s emotions flared. “Love token? That’s a joke!”

Thalia looked confused. “Mom, what are you talking about?”

Shyla whipped around to face the window and took several deep breaths before her emotions settled. “Thalia, those sapphire earrings don’t belong to your grandmother, and she shouldn’t have them. You should give them back to Miya.”

Thalia felt like she was dreaming. She thought, ‘Shyla is Grandma’s daughter, but she’s saying this? Shouldn’t have them? Don’t belong to Grandma?’

The words didn’t register at first, and Thalia’s voice softened. “Mom, can you please explain what you mean?”

“Stop asking questions,” Shyla said with a frown. “Just listen to me. Did you bring them home today?”

“I’m not giving them to Miya,” Thalia said, shaking her head. “They belong to Grandma.”

They don’t belong to your grandmother,” Shyla shot back. “Your grandmother stole them!”

Her eyes filled with embarrassment and frustration, then disgust, as if she was recalling something shameful from the past.

Thalia couldn’t believe what she was hearing. “Mom, did you hit your head or something?” she asked. “How can you say something like that?”

Shyla’s expression turned serious. “You need to stop spending so much time with her,” she said. “She’s been a bad influence on you.”

Thalia took two steps back and shook her head. “This is insane,” she said. “I don’t believe you. Grandma has always been good to me and she hasn’t done anything wrong. Don’t badmouth her like this.”

Thalia!” Shyla reached for her hand, but Thalia turned and headed for the door.

Shyla watched her go, and her expression grew conflicted. She bit her lip and finally spoke up. “Those earrings were a gift your grandfather gave to his first love,” she said. “Your grandma saw them and claimed they were hers. If that’s not stealing. then what is?”

Thalia froze in her tracks. She turned around slowly, disbelief written all over her face. “What are you talking about?” she asked.

Shyla let out a heavy sigh. “I didn’t want to tell you,” she said, “but she’s been turning you against us and now she’s using those earrings to drive a wedge between us. I don’t need to cover for her anymore.”

She grabbed Thalia’s hand and pulled her upstairs. Once they were in the bedroom with the door closed, Shyla looked at her
